/**
*Given an array S of n integers, are there elements a, b, c in S such that a + b + c = 0? Find all unique
*triplets in the array which gives the sum of zero.
*Note:
*Elements in a triplet (a,b,c) must be in non-descending order. (ie, a ≤ b ≤ c)
*The solution set must not contain duplicate triplets.
* For example, given array S = {-1 0 1 2 -1 -4},
* A solution set is:
* (-1, 0, 1)
* (-1, -1, 2)
*/
class Solution {
public:
vector<vector<int>> threeSum(vector<int>& nums) {
vector<vector<int> > res;
sort(nums.begin(),nums.end());
for(int i = 0; i < nums.size(); i++)
{
int sum = -nums[i];
int front = i + 1;
int back = nums.size() - 1;
while(front < back)
{
if(nums[front]+nums[back] > sum)
back--;
else if(nums[front]+nums[back] < sum)
front++;
else
{
vector<int> tri;
tri.push_back(nums[i]);
tri.push_back(nums[front]);
tri.push_back(nums[back]);
res.push_back(tri);
while(front < back && nums[front] == tri[1])
front++;
while(front < back && nums[back] == tri[2])
back--;
}
}
while(i+1 < nums.size() && nums[i] == nums[i+1])
i++;
}
return res;
}
};
